Bitcoin Mining Sector Consolidation: Strategic Divestitures and the Path to Operational Efficiency
The BitcoinBTC-- mining sector is undergoing a seismic shift as companies grapple with the aftermath of the 2024 halving, which slashed block rewards by 50%. This structural challenge has forced operators to adopt aggressive cost-cutting measures, strategic divestitures, and operational overhauls to maintain profitability. According to a report by Coin Telegraph, the network hashrate surged 77% year-over-year, reaching 921 EH/s in May 2025, as firms prioritized efficiency over expansion [1]. This article evaluates how strategic divestitures and technological upgrades are reshaping the industry's competitive landscape and long-term viability.
Strategic Divestitures: A Catalyst for Focus and Efficiency
One of the most striking trends in 2023–2025 has been the exit of mining firms from non-core business segments. CanaanCAN--, for instance, divested its AI semiconductor division to concentrate on Bitcoin mining, a move that aligns with broader industry efforts to streamline operations [2]. Similarly, Genesis Digital Assets shifted resources toward energy-efficient hardware and grid-stabilization programs, reducing electricity costs by leveraging demand-response incentives [2]. These divestitures reflect a sector-wide recognition that operational simplicity and specialization are critical to surviving margin compression.
The rationale behind such moves is clear: Bitcoin's post-halving economics demand razor-thin cost structures. With production costs rising over 9% in Q2 2025, miners are no longer able to justify diversification into high-risk, low-margin ventures [1]. Instead, they are reallocating capital to high-impact areas, such as advanced ASICs and low-cost energy procurement. For example, Bitmain's Antminer S21+ and MicroBT's WhatsMiner M66S+ now achieve energy efficiencies of 16.5 J/TH and 17 J/TH, respectively, enabling operators to offset declining block rewards [1].
Operational Efficiency as a Survival Imperative
The race for efficiency has also driven geographic reallocation. Companies like CleanSparkCLSK-- and Hut 8HUT-- have expanded operations to regions with ultra-low electricity rates, such as Oman and the UAE, where costs range from $0.035–$0.07 per kWh [1]. This trend underscores the sector's pivot toward energy arbitrage, with firms leveraging underutilized or renewable energy sources to maintain cost advantages.
Moreover, the adoption of AI-driven analytics is optimizing mining operations. BitdeerBTDR-- and Cipher MiningCIFR-- have paused traditional capacity expansions to invest in machine learning tools that predict equipment failures and optimize energy consumption [2]. These innovations are not merely incremental—they are existential for firms facing a 50% reduction in block rewards. As Bitcoin Mining Zone notes, “Operational efficiency is no longer optional; it has become a necessity for survival” [2].
Long-Term Profitability: Treasury Strategies and Diversification
While cost-cutting is critical, long-term profitability hinges on strategic Bitcoin treasury management. Firms like Marathon Digital and Riot PlatformsRIOT-- have adopted a model akin to MicroStrategy's, retaining mined Bitcoin as both a reserve asset and a hedge against fiat volatility [3]. By treating Bitcoin as a corporate treasury asset, these companies aim to capitalize on its long-term appreciation while insulating themselves from short-term price swings.
Diversification into AI and high-performance computing (HPC) is another avenue for stability. Hive Digital's repurposing of NvidiaNVDA-- GPUs for AI applications generated revenues exceeding traditional mining, while Hut 8's HPC/AI segment contributed 8% of its total revenue in 2024 [3]. This dual-income model mitigates reliance on Bitcoin's price volatility and positions firms to benefit from the AI boom.
Consolidation and the New Industry Order
Consolidation is accelerating as smaller, less efficient operators exit the market. By early 2025, 12 firms controlled 30% of the network's hashrate, up from 22% in January 2024 [2]. Large consolidators like Cipher Mining and Bitdeer are scaling through acquisitions and infrastructure investments, such as Cipher Mining's 300 MW Black Pearl data center in Texas, which aims to reach 23.1 EH/s by Q3 2025 [4]. This concentration reflects the capital-intensive nature of modern mining, where scale and technological prowess are decisive advantages.
